Transaction f696f78e1ef3b13abd1d24ddcac7a41bc67902303f0cc18b710101f35a393a5f
1 Input
1 Output
-
f696f78e1ef3b13abd1d24ddcac7a41bc67902303f0cc18b710101f35a393a5f:0
- value
- 3896108
- script pubkey
- OP_0 OP_PUSHBYTES_20 50e9a6ea0ae1b86241ba16b7bf1e77d46be7e30a
- address
- bc1q2r56d6s2uxuxysd6z6mm78nh63470cc2jaqzz3